Biggest Bold Predictions for Day 2
According to CBS Sports, several standout scenarios could unfold during Rounds 2 and 3.
Denzel Boston Could Land With the Raiders
One major prediction suggests wide receiver Denzel Boston could be selected by Las Vegas, giving No. 1 overall pick Fernando Mendoza another weapon to grow with. After using the first pick on a quarterback, adding a dynamic receiver would accelerate the rebuild.
Carson Beck Could Become QB3
Former Miami quarterback Carson Beck is another player drawing major interest. CBS Sports predicted Beck could become the third quarterback selected in the draft, signaling a strong market for passers even after Round 1.
Trades Could Shake Up the Board
Day 2 historically features aggressive movement as teams trade up for falling prospects. With several Round 1 talents still on the board, front offices may package picks to jump into key spots.
That means Friday night could include:
- Teams trading up for quarterbacks
- Contenders targeting defensive starters
- Clubs adding offensive line depth
- Surprise reaches based on scheme fit

Teams to Watch
Several franchises are expected to be aggressive Friday night:
- New York Giants – Need help at cornerback and receiver
- New York Jets – Could target secondary or offensive line depth
- Cincinnati Bengals – Defense remains a focus
- Jacksonville Jaguars – Skill positions and trench depth
Multiple analysts also expect playoff teams to trade up if elite prospects slide.
